One of the big Oscar movies maybe going to Telluride but might hit the Venice/Telluride one two punch is Damien Chazelle’s third major feature, after Whiplash and La La Land. First Man is directed by Chazelle, written by Nicole Perlman and Josh Singer, adapted from a book by James R. Hansen.
